alkyne [al′kīn] an unsaturated aliphatic hydrocarbon containing at least one triple bond in the carbon chain, such as acetylene. alkyne (alˑ·kīnˈ), n unsaturated hydrocarbon compound that has triple covalent bonds and CnH2n−2 as the general chemical formula.
